My Buying Guides on Insulin Syringe With Needle
Understanding What I Look for First
When I buy an insulin syringe with needle, I first make sure it matches the insulin type and dose I use. I pay attention to the syringe capacity, because using the wrong size can make measuring difficult. I also check whether the needle is attached and whether it is the right length and gauge for comfortable use.
Choosing the Right Syringe Size
I always choose a syringe that fits my usual insulin dose. If I use smaller doses, I prefer a smaller syringe because it helps me measure more accurately. For larger doses, I look for a bigger capacity so I do not have to refill or split the dose.
Needle Length and Comfort
Needle length matters to me because it affects comfort and how easy it is to inject. I usually look for a length that feels manageable and is recommended for my injection method. A thinner needle can also make the injection feel less painful, so I keep gauge in mind too.
Reading the Scale Clearly
I prefer syringes with clear, easy-to-read markings. This helps me avoid mistakes when drawing insulin. If the numbers are faint or crowded, I skip that option because accuracy is important to me.
Checking Compatibility
I always confirm that the syringe is compatible with the insulin concentration I use, such as U-100. This is important because using the wrong syringe can lead to dosing errors. I never assume all insulin syringes are the same.
Sterility and Packaging
I look for individually sealed, sterile syringes. Clean packaging gives me confidence that the product is safe to use. I also check the expiration date before buying, because I want every syringe to be fresh and reliable.
Comfort and Ease of Use
I prefer syringes that feel easy to handle, especially if I need to inject regularly. A smooth plunger and a well-made needle can make the process simpler. I also like products that are designed to reduce leakage and improve control.
Buying in the Right Quantity
I consider how often I use insulin before choosing a pack size. Buying in bulk can be convenient and cost-effective, but only if I know I will use them before they expire. For me, it is better to buy a quantity that matches my routine.
